WebJan 17, 2024 · T cells (also called T lymphocytes) are major components of the adaptive immune system. Their roles include directly killing infected host cells, activating other immune cells, producing cytokines and regulating the immune response. This article discusses T cell production, the different T cell types and relevant clinical conditions.
